The Coastal and Estuarine Research Federation biennial conference is taking place this week and Wells Reserve scientists are well represented on the agenda. Reserve staff are participating in these presentations and posters:

  • Fostering Coastal Stewardship: New Tools for Bridging the Science to Management Divide
  • Indicators of Fringing Salt Marsh Ecological Function that are Responsive to Shoreline Development Pressures
  • Synthesis of SWMP Data for ASSETS Eutrophication Assessment of the North Atlantic Region NERR Systems
  • Response of the American Eel to Saltmarsh Restoration and Its Role in Trophic Dynamics
  • Nekton Response to Hydrologic Restoration of New England Salt Marsh-Estuarine Ecosystems
  • Developing a Nekton Index of Ecological State for Gulf of Maine Fringing Tidal Marsh

Who's representing Wells Reserve in Providence, Rhode Island? Michele Dionne, Jeremy Miller, Andrea Leonard, Cayce Dalton, and several collaborators from partner institutions.
